MANILA, Philippines – Far Eastern University (FEU) and National University (NU) registered straight sets victories on Wednesday to keep their places in the top four of the UAAP Season 79 men's volleyball tournament at the Filoil Flying V Centre in San Juan.

The NU Bulldogs cruised to a 25-23, 25-18, 25-19 victory over University of Santo Tomas (UST) to improve to 5-1 and stay at solo second.

Fauzi Ismail and Francis Saura each scored 12 points, while Bryan Bagunas added 10 markers, as the Bulldogs used their superior net defense to frustrate the Tiger Spikers.

NU had 10 kill blocks, and also served up seven aces, while Kim Dayandante orchestrated their offense en route to 45 excellent sets.

Only Jerico Jose finished in double digits for UST with 10 points, as the Tiger Spikers converted only 24 of 88 attack attempts.

UST dropped to 3-3.

The FEU Tamaraws, meanwhile, rode the momentum of their win in an extended first set to romp past University of the Philippines (UP), 27-25, 25-17, 25-20, to improve to 4-2 and stay in third place.

Jude Garcia had 12 points built on all-around numbers of seven attacks, three blocks, and two aces, while Peter Quiel added 10 points, all of which came on attacks.

Mark Millete had 16 points and Wendel Miguel added 11 for the Fighting Maroons, but their performance was hampered by 28 unforced errors.

UP is now at 3-3, tied with UST for a share of fourth place. Still pacing the men's division are the defending champions Ateneo de Manila University Blue Eagles (6-0).
